Introduction
Uninterruptible Power Supply (UPS) systems are critical for ensuring continuous power availability and protecting sensitive equipment from power disturbances such as outages, voltage fluctuations, and surges. UPS systems are widely used in data centers, healthcare facilities, industrial operations, and commercial buildings to maintain operational continuity and prevent data loss or equipment damage.
